Planning appeal decision

Dismissed8 May 20243327611

Former Sewage Works, Church Fields, Upper South Wraxall, Wiltshire, BA15 2SB

erection of a dwellinghouse

Authority
Wiltshire Council
Appeal type
minor · Planning Appeal
Procedure
Written Representations
Development
residential · Minor Dwellings
Inspector
O'Doherty A

Main issues, as the Inspector framed them

  • whether the proposed development would be inappropriate development in the Green Belt having regard to the National Planning Policy Framework and any relevant development plan policies
  • whether the site would provide a suitable location for residential development, having particular regard to the settlement strategy for the area and its accessibility by sustainable forms of transport
  • whether any harm by reason of inappropriateness, and any other harm, would be clearly outweighed by other considerations, so as to amount to the very special circumstances required to justify the proposed development

What decided it

The proposed development would be inappropriate development in the Green Belt with substantial harm to its openness, and the site would not provide a suitable location for residential development, with the identified harms not clearly outweighed by other considerations.
